MySQL Forums
Forum List  »  German

Re: Speicherzuweisung für den mysql daemon???
Posted by: Lenz Grimmer
Date: November 13, 2006 12:04PM

Hi,

Patrick Kummutat Wrote:
-------------------------------------------------------

> ich habe mir zuhause eine Rechner zusammengebaut,
> der mit 4 GB Ram bestueckt ist.OS (SUSE 10.0)

Was für eine Version? 32bit oder 64bit?

> Dadrauf hab ich einen mysql Daemon laufen. Jetzt
> wuerde ich gerne der mysql mehr Speicher zuweisen.

Warum, beschwert er sich über zuwenig Speicher?

> Wie kann ich dem Daemon mehr speicher zuweisen?

Das macht der MySQL-Server normalerweise selbständig.
Aber es ist natürlich möglich, MySQL zu sagen wofür
er Speicher reservieren soll (z.B. Caches). Aber dafür solltest
Du erstmal feststellen, ob es irgendwo einen Engpaß gibt - das
ist sehr von der Workload abhängig.

> Ist es ueberhaupt möglich der mysql mehr wie 1GB
> zu zuweisen?

Auf einem 32-bit Linux-System kann mysqld bis zu 3.5GB Speicher reservieren. Auf einem 64-bit System um einiges mehr.

> Wo kann ich mysql sagen wo es hin swappen soll?
> (/etc/my.cnf)? :-)

Gar nicht - swapping ist Sache des Betriebssystems. Das legst Du
unter Linux in der Datei /etc/fstab fest.

> Meine Idee war jetzt Ramdisks zu mounten und wenn
> die mysql versucht zu swappen, denn nicht auf die
> HDD swappen zu lassen, sondern einfach wieder in
> den Arbeitsspeicher, ist das eine Möglichkeit die
> mysql schneller zu machen?

Nein, das wird nichts bringen.

Bye,
LenZ

Lenz Grimmer - MySQL Community Relations Manager - http://de.sun.com/
Sun Microsystems GmbH, Sonnenallee 1, 85551 Kirchheim-Heimstetten, DE
Geschaeftsfuehrer: Thomas Schroeder, Wolfgang Engels
Vorsitz d. Aufsichtsrates: Martin Haering AG Muenchen: HRB161028

Options: ReplyQuote


Subject
Views
Written By
Posted
Re: Speicherzuweisung für den mysql daemon???
4911
November 13, 2006 12:04PM


Sorry, you can't reply to this topic. It has been closed.

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.